The invention relates to a double flap device (1, 1') for the sealed connection of two receptacles (3; 5), having two housings halves (10; 20) between which a detachable connection can be produced, in each case one flap (12; 22) per housing half (10; 20), wherein the flap is pivotably mounted in the associated housing half (10; 20), the housing halves (10; 20) and the flaps (12; 22) resting on one another and being tensioned against one another when the double flap device (1) is in a connected position. The two flaps (12; 22) can be pivoted as a double flap between a closed position and an open position, it being possible in the open position for a free-flowing product to be transferred from a first (3) into a second (5) of the receptacles (3, 5) in a flow direction (D). The double flap device (1, 1') comprises at least one unit (100) for cleaning at least one of the flaps (12; 22) and a flap chamber (15, 25). The invention further relates to a method for cleaning flaps (12; 22) of such a double flap device.
The invention relates to dual flap device (1, 1') for the environmentally tight connection of two receptacles (3, 5). The dual flap device is provided with two housing halves (10, 10'; 20, 20'), which can be releasably connected. Each housing half (10, 10'; 20, 20') accommodates a flap (12, 12'; 22, 22'), which is pivotable by way of a half shaft (14, 24). In a connected position of the dual flap device (1, 1'), the housing halves (10, 10'; 20, 20') and the flaps (12, 12'; 22, 22') rest against each other and are tensioned against one another, respectively. The half shafts (14, 24) of the two flaps (12, 12'; 22, 22') unite to form a mutual shaft (15) having a rotational axis (A). Thus, using a locking device (40, 40'), both flaps (12, 12'; 22, 22') can be pivoted between a closed position and an open position by way of the mutual shaft (15). According to the invention, a first housing half (10, 10') is provided with a locking device (30, 30'), at least on one side, located in axial extension of the respective half shaft (14), which makes it possible to switch the dual flap device (1, 1') between an unlocked and a locked position.
The invention relates to a valve (1, 1') for extracting a sample from a content (11) of a tank (10). The sampling must occur without contamination. To this end, according to the invention, the valve (1, 1') comprises a stationary part (20, 20') securely connected to the tank (10), a mobile part (40, 40') releaseably connected to the stationary part (20, 20'), and an actuating mechanism (24) for switching between a base position and a switched position. The stationary part (20, 20') comprises a rotatably supported first partial body (32, 32') of a shutoff body (30, 30') substantially rotationally symmetrical about an axis (A). The mobile part (40, 40') comprises a rotatably supported second partial body (34, 34') of the shutoff body (30, 30'). The first partial body (32, 32') and/or the second partial body (34, 34') comprise a recess (50, 70) for receiving or conveying the sample.
